Recognizing Bloating



Several individuals experience bloating at some factor in their lives, yet the underlying causes and ramifications for digestive system health can be complex. Bloating is defined by a sensation of fullness or tightness in the abdomen, typically come with by noticeable distension. This condition can arise from numerous variables, including dietary selections, stomach conditions, and way of life practices.


Typical nutritional culprits consist of high-fiber foods, carbonated beverages, and particular sugars that are inadequately absorbed in the intestine. Lactose intolerance can lead to bloating after consuming milk items, while excessive consumption of beans may trigger gas manufacturing. Additionally, overindulging or eating also promptly can intensify the feeling of bloating, as the body battles to process large quantities of food efficiently.


Intestinal conditions, such as short-tempered digestive tract syndrome (IBS) or celiac illness, can additionally complicate the experience of bloating, as they usually entail enhanced level of sensitivity and impaired digestion. Recognizing the particular triggers and systems behind bloating is crucial for effective administration and therapy, making it possible for individuals to make informed nutritional and way of life changes to advertise ideal digestive health and wellness.


Identifying Body Fat





Identifying the difference in between bloating and body fat is vital for understanding one's general digestive system wellness and physical problem. Body fat describes the adipose tissue that is kept in different areas of the body, working as an energy reserve and playing necessary duties in hormonal agent guideline and thermal insulation. It is necessary to precisely determine body fat to analyze health and wellness risks related to too much adiposity, such as cardio condition and diabetes.


To recognize body fat, individuals can make use of numerous methods, including body mass index (BMI), skinfold measurements, and bioelectrical impedance evaluation. BMI is an extensively used device that associates weight and elevation; however, it might not accurately show body structure. Skinfold dimensions include squeezing various areas of the body to gauge fat density, while bioelectrical insusceptibility makes use of electric currents to estimate body fat percentage.


Aesthetic examination can also play a role in acknowledging body fat circulation, which can offer insight right into health implications. For instance, visceral fat bordering the body organs poses higher health and wellness threats contrasted to subcutaneous fat situated simply underneath the skin. Recognizing these subtleties is important for embracing ideal health methods and boosting total wellness.

Dietary selections also play a substantial role in bloating. Particular foods, especially those high in fiber, such as beans, lentils, and cruciferous veggies, might lead to gas manufacturing during food digestion. Furthermore, carbonated beverages can introduce excess gas into the digestion system.


Food intolerances and sensitivities, such as lactose intolerance or gluten level of sensitivity, are other prevalent root causes of bloating. When individuals take in foods they can not properly digest, it can lead to gas and pain.


In addition, hormone changes, especially in women during the menstruation cycle, can contribute to bloating as a result of water retention and intestinal adjustments. Underlying medical conditions, such as short-tempered bowel syndrome (IBS) or gastrointestinal obstruction, might likewise manifest as bloating, stressing the relevance of suitable diagnosis and monitoring. Understanding these reasons is crucial for reliable signs and symptom management.
